摘要
风口小套是高炉的关键设备,是热交换极为强烈的冷却元件,其在高温状态下不间断地受到液态渣铁和煤粉的冲刷,是高炉易损的设备。风口小套的破损与更换已成为高炉无计划休风增多的主要原因,针对如何优化风口小套供水条件来提高风口小套使用寿命,进行探讨。
As a critical equipment of blast furnace, tuyere small sleeve is a cooling component with strong heat exchange and an easily damaged BF element, suffering continuous flushing of liquid slag, hot metal and pulverized coal under high temperature. Damage and replacement of tuyere small sleeve have become the major reason for increasing nonscheduled shutdown of blast furnace. Therefore, this article discusses on optimization of the water supply condition for tuyere small sleeve so as to improve the service life of tuyere small sleeve.
